Basically mate, you have your multiplier set too high.
Your Corsair XMS4400 is capable of running at 275mhz at 2.5-3-3-8. Your HTT should be set to 3, not 5 (you might be able to get away with 4). 3 * 275 = <1000 4 * 275 = 1100 Should ideally be around 1000. The default is 5 x 200 = 1000. Drop your CPU multiplier to 10, HTT to 3, up the CPU voltage to 1.5V and the RAM REQUIRES 2.75V minimum. Bet it works [img]tongue.gif[/img]

Maybe we were a bit ambitious with the CPU multiplier.
Try 9 x 275 (2495) with the other settings as described above. If that works, up it to 9.5 on the multiplier (2612.5), though this may need a tiny processor voltage increase to compensate. EDIT: Also, up the NForce4 chipset voltage to 1.75V. [ 05-13-2005, 08:37 PM: Message edited by: Dace De'Briago ]
